2. External Modulation Input Connector
When the modulation source of AM or FM/ØM is
set to "Ext", this connector is used to input the
external modulating signal.
3. Signal Valid Output Connector
When the RF output frequency or amplitude is
modified, after a certain response and processing
time of the internal circuit of the instrument, the
instrument outputs RF signal with the specified
frequency and amplitude via the RF output
connector at the front panel. During this process,
the [SIGNAL VALID] connector outputs a pulse
sync signal, indicating that the RF output signal is
valid.
High Level (+3.3 V): indicate that the RF
signal is in configuration.
Low Level (0 V): indicate that the RF signal is
stable (namely, the signal is valid).

4. External Trigger Input Connector
When the trigger mode of SWEEP is “Ext”, this
connector is used to input the external trigger
signal. You can press Trig Slope to set the
polarity of the trigger signal to "Pos" or "Neg".
When the pulse modulation source is "Int" and the
trigger mode is "Ext Trig", it is used to input the
external trigger signal.
When the pulse modulation source is "Int" and the
trigger mode is "Ext Gate", it is used to input the
external gated signal.
